Introduction to the procedures and principles of precision stamping die assembly

The key to the assembly of precision stamping parts is how to ensure that the relative positions of the convex and concave molds installed on the upper and lower mold seats and the various parts related to them can work normally when the mold is closed, and the workpiece that meets the product requirements can be punched . For this reason, it needs to be mentioned that all kinds of parts put into assembly must meet the processing requirements of all kinds of parts put forward by the assembly process. For example, for a fixed plate with multiple punches, the relative position, dimensional accuracy and step distance accuracy between the various holes must be consistent with the die and the unloading plate; the bolts and pins on the backing plate have a large gap through the holes. Drilling according to the size of the pattern, the upper and lower surfaces should be grounded strictly after quenching; the integral die installed on the upper or lower mold base, in addition to the various holes that meet the pattern requirements, bolts should also be processed Holes and pin holes are put into assembly after heat treatment and finishing. The mold bases and guide plates that need to be connected and fixed. The screw holes and pin holes on them should be drilled and matched according to the corresponding holes on the die during assembly. Hinge. Based on this, although the mold types and structural characteristics of precision stamping parts are different, the assembly methods and installation sequences used are also different, but the assembly principles that should be followed are the same. When assembling the precision stamping part mold, you first need to select the assembly reference part, use it as the assembly reference of the precision stamping part mold, and then gradually assemble other mold parts according to the reference part; the choice of the reference part depends on the structural characteristics of the precision stamping part mold; The guide plate that also serves as the unloading plate should be selected as the assembly reference part; the precision stamping part dies guided by the guide pillar usually use the concave die as the assembly reference part; the blanking and punching compound die selects the pusher plate as the assembly reference part, and It is a prerequisite that the output center/center point of the pusher plate is aligned with the center/center of the mold handle. After the reference parts are selected, the various parts of the precision stamping die are first assembled into an assembly according to the individual connection relationship between them, and then the precision stamping die is assembled using the reference parts as the assembly reference.
